Forbidden error


I have this config, if ill going to remove the setvar it works, but if I place that one, the error occurs. the purpose of the SetVar is to change the call recording in different location for that specific numbers

exten => 8613808110,1,SetVar(DIREC=/var/spool/asterisk/sample)
exten => 8613808110,2,Ringing(4)
exten => 8613808110,3,Set(CALLFILENAME=${CALLERID(num)}-${EXTEN}-${STRFTIME(${EPOCH},%Y$
exten => 8613808110,4,Monitor(gsm,${CALLFILENAME},m
exten => 8613808110,5,SetCallerID(“Viatel”<${CALLERID(NUM)}>[|a])
exten => 8613808110,6,Dial(SIP/899&SIP/900)

[2011-08-01 21:06:08] WARNING[18821]: chan_sip.c:12334 handle_response_invite: Received response: “Forbidden” from ‘“8767891234”;tag=as214376ac’
– SIP/ is circuit-busy
== Everyone is busy/congested at this time (1:0/1/0)
– Executing [818613808110@outgoing:5] Congestion(“SIP/1110-01e2e360”, “”) in new stack

The only line that could result in forbidden is the SetCallerID one.

Note that application is deprecated and the "s round Viatel serve no purpose, and may even confuse older versions of Asterisk.

sorry, ill transfer this one into Asterisk Support.